LWF World Service is the humanitarian and development arm of the Lutheran World Federation. We are a widely recognized, international, faith-based organization working in over 20 countries. We seek to bring people of all backgrounds together in the common quest for justice, peace, and reconciliation in an increasingly complex and fragmented world. 

A commitment to the human rights of every individual, regardless of their status, guides our work, actions, and operations. We are particularly known for our timely, compassionate, and professional humanitarian work, and for our field presence in hard-to-reach areas. Our work is people-centered and community- based. Above all, we work with the most vulnerable, and in order to claim and uphold their rights, we engage proactively with local government and community structures. 

Our partners in (Ethiopia) include Ethiopian Evangelical Church Mekane Yesus (EECMY), diaconal arms of Lutheran churches (Related Agencies), the European Commission (ECHO), the US Government (BPRM) and UN Agencies, Global Affairs Canada with whom we are a key implementing partner. 

LWF World Service Ethiopia is a registered foreign charity that has been operating in Ethiopia since 1973 implementing various development and humanitarian projects in different parts of Ethiopia.

Main duties and responsibilities of the Position Holder:

He / She Shall:

Leadership

  • Provide leadership to ensures efficient financial management of the program activities and administration, and ensures that the financial transactions are conducted in accordance with the relevant LWF priorities and procedures;

  • Assists the Regional Coordinator in the overall Supervision of the project financial activities and ensures that the daily routines are carried out smoothly and ensure mutual accountability.

Program management

  • Together with the Regional Coordinator, support finance policies, priorities, procedures and guidelines for all the LWF programs in the Tigray region.

  • Prepare regular fund requests together with the program staffs based on the planned activities.

  • Ensure that LWF Procurement Procedures are followed and relevant financial documents, such as purchase requisitions, proforma invoice, purchase order, and Goods receiving Notes are properly raised.

  • Participate in the preparation of periodic working budgets jointly with the program staffs.

  • See to it that adequate stock of supplies is requested on time and maintained in accordance to LWF policy.

  • Facilitate preparation of timely and accurate finance reports for the various projects in accordance to LWF and donor regulations.

  • Code all disbursements and receipts according to LWF/ET procedure.

  • Make sure that all disbursements are summarized according to the cost centers and account codes.

  • Ensure accuracy and timeliness of all financial statements before they are sent to the Head Office.

  • Control and assist the Secretary/Cashier in the day-to-day management of petty cash and other financial responsibilities. Makes surprise cash counts and reports to the Regional Coordinator.

  • Prepare monthly bank reconciliation statements and share with Finance Manager.

  • Supervise the Store Keepers and see to it that appropriate store procedures are strictly adhered to in accordance with LWF procedures.

  • Make sure that all project fixed assets are registered properly in accordance with LWF procedures.

  • Prepare monthly Payroll/Pay Sheet for Casual workers if any, based on the approved attendance and other relevant documents in consultation with the Team Leader.

  • Together with the Regional Coordinator and other staffs, ensure that all purchases and disbursements in regard to budgetary provisions and stipulations are in line with the allocated budget lines.  

  • Make sure that all necessary and appropriate taxes are deducted and paid to the concerned Tax Authority Offices on time

  • Work with program staffs in development of funding proposals in accordance to LWF policy and donor requirements.

  • Ensures close and complementary working relations of finance and program units;

 Human resource

  • Acts as the direct supervisor of finance staffs in Tigray region

  • Ensures that new staff are provided with thorough orientation to the LWF’s priorities and guiding principles as a humanitarian organization, the LWF field program and the project to which they are assigned;

  • Reviews training needs of staff involved in finances.

  • Work with Regional Coordinator to design and carry appropriate finance related trainings for staffs.

  • Perform other duties in line with his responsibilities as may be assigned to him by the supervisor.
